Kindly Update the Software Options List

Hello devs. I’ve been using DietPi OS for 3 years in a row on my RPi 0 to RPi 5 plus a couple of other boards like Librelec, and Orange Pi. All my SBCs run only and only DietPi.

For a past couple of days, I am experimenting with various Music Server software available on the dietpi-software list. I just want the DietPi devs to please ensure the Software Options List here is timely updated. As I have come across several programmes that are listed in the documentation list but not available in the dietpi-software list or vice-versa.

Thanks for this wonderful and most capable OS.

Depending on your software option, it might be disabled for a specific chip architecture. What do you missing? Maybe we can crosscheck.

MPD.
Raspberry Pi Zero W.

Another example, myMPD is in the documentation but not in the dietpi-software list.

Thanks for the input, I will check it.

1 Like

you can check the availability different of mpd service as follow:

dietpi-software list | grep mpd

For example it’s available for my RPi4 which uses ARMv8, but your Pi Zero W uses ARMv6 and you would need to compile it yourself, if you wanna use it. They don’t provide prebuild binaries for this architecture.
https://download.opensuse.org/repositories/home:/jcorporation/Debian_12/

Ok, but where’s the documentation for MPD and many other apps. I’ve mentioned the lack of documentations here..
On my RPi 4 I found some mismatch in the following apps related docs.

  1. Roon Server.
  2. Spotifyd.
  3. MPD.

In these aforementioned apps some aren’t available in the dietpi-software list and some don’t have documentation.

As already said. Not all apps are available on every system. It depends on your hardware and Debian version.

You can use following to check

dietpi-software list | grep <app name>

It’s under media systems, you checked the wrong category. There is also a search function on top of the page.
For almost every app there is a link to the apps official docs, where you can check architecture compatibility.

If you find missing docs you can feel free to add them:
https://github.com/MichaIng/DietPi-Docs

1 Like

@homie: You are right that MPD has no own documentation section. I.e., it is selectable in dietpi-software but does not appear in the DietPi docs software description.
That we could fix/extend.

Are there other software packages which are not present in the software list you mentioned?
If I want to find a software package, I go to the software list and search with <ctrl>-<f> (using the browser internal search option instead of the DietPi docs search option).

Reason for MPD is that it is a backend for myMPD, O!MPD etc, so commonly not installed on its own. But still makes sense to add it, at least to mention how we configure it by default (“default” ALSA PCM) and that it can be further configured with dietpi-justboom (dietpi-config submenu), cross-linking CAVA console visualizer etc.

We could also add platform compatibility/availability to the docs, but I fear the additional maintenance efforts this causes. First we should implement some central information system, from where website, docs and probably even DietPi scripts grab such meta info. If someone has time and mood to work on such :slightly_smiling_face:.